Taylor Alison Swift is an American singer-songwriter who was born on December 13, 1989, in Reading, Pennsylvania. She grew up on a Christmas tree farm in nearby Wyomissing, Pennsylvania, and developed a love for music at a young age. Swift started playing guitar when she was 12 years old and began writing songs shortly thereafter. At age 14 she moved to Nashville to become a country artist. 

She signed a songwriting deal with Sony/ATV Music Publishing in 2004 and a recording contract with Big Machine Records in 2005. In 2006, Swift released her debut album, titled “Taylor Swift,” which included the hit singles “Teardrops on My Guitar” and “Our Song.” The self-titled album went on to become certified platinum and launched Swift’s career in the music industry.

Swift followed up her debut album with the release of “Fearless” in 2008. The album included the hit singles “Love Story” and “You Belong with Me” and became one of the best-selling albums of all time. Swift won numerous awards for her work on “Fearless,” including four Grammy Awards.

Over the next few years, she released several more successful albums, including “Speak Now” in 2010, “Red” in 2012, and “1989” in 2014. Each album showcased Swift’s growth as an artist and her ability to connect with her fans through her songwriting.

In 2020, Swift released two critically acclaimed albums, “Folklore” and “Evermore,” which showcased a more mature and introspective side of her music. She also became involved in a highly publicized dispute with her former record label over ownership of her early music catalog.

Throughout her career, Swift has won numerous awards, including 11 Grammy Awards, 27 Billboard Music Awards, and 34 American Music Awards. She has sold over 50 million albums and 150 million singles worldwide, making her one of the best-selling music artists of all time.
